深入解析vmess与vless:理解这两种网络协议的差异和优势

在现代互联网环境中,网络安全与隐私保护显得尤为重要。在许多科学上网工具中,vmess与vless是两种非常重要的网络协议。本文将深入解释这两个协议的含义、特性、主要区别以及各自的应用场景。

什么是vmess?

vmess是一种用于在网络上实现加密通讯的协议,主要用于搭建V2Ray这一翻墙软件。它提供了一种灵活的网络传输方式,其功能包括,但不限于:

  • 数据加密:保证在互联网中传输的数据不被第三方窃取。
  • 伪装:使网络流量难以被识别,从而能够更好地隐蔽数据传输。
  • 多种传输方式支持:包括TCP、WebSocket等。

vmess协议的设置较为复杂,但因其安全性和灵活性,广受用户欢迎。

什么是vless?

vless可以视为vmess的轻量化版本,它是V2Ray在协议上的一种升级。vless的特点包括:

  • 简化的协议结构:相较于vmess,vless去掉了一些不必要的功能,使得整体更加轻巧。
  • 更高的传输效率:由于协议的简化,vless在高延迟、低带宽的网络环境下表现更佳。
  • 支持不同的加密方式:vless可以灵活配置不同的加密算法,以适应用户需求。

vmess与vless的主要区别

1. 协议架构

  • 复杂性:vmess相对于vless更为复杂,包含更多的功能和选项。
  • 灵活性:vless因其简化的设计,提供了更高的灵活性。

2. 性能

  • 速度:vless在性能上通常优于vmess,特别是在高负载网络环境下。
  • 资源占用:vless由于占用更少资源,适合在低配置的设备上运行。

3. 使用场景

  • vmess:更适合需要复杂配置和特殊功能的使用场景。
  • vless:在要求较高性能与简化配置环境下使用更为理想。

vmess和vless的优缺点

vmess的优点:

  • 功能全面:支持丰富的功能选项。
  • 灵活性强:能够满足多种连接需求。

vmess的缺点:

  • 设置复杂:对于新手用户来说,配置相对繁琐。
  • 性能不足:在低带宽、高延迟环境下,表现可能不佳。

vless的优点:

  • 简洁明了:易于配置和使用。
  • 高性能:适合于各种网络环境。

vless的缺点:

  • 功能有限:相比vmess,某些高级功能缺失。
  • 不够灵活:在特定情况下可能无法满足需求。

哪个协议更适合您?

选择vmess还是vless取决于您的具体需求:

  • 如果您需要更强大的功能和灵活性,vmess可能是更好的选择。
  • 如果您更关注性能和易用性,vless则可能更加适合。

FAQ(常见问题解答)

1. vmess和vless可以共存吗?

是的,vmess与vless可以在同一台V2Ray服务器上共存。用户可以根据需求选择适合的协议进行连接。

2. 如何选择最合适的加密方式?

选择加密方式时,需要考虑以下因素:

  • 安全性:选择公认的安全算法。
  • 性能:某些加密方式可能会影响整体性能,需权衡。
  • 兼容性:确保所选加密方式能够兼容您的设备和网络环境。

3. 如何配置vmess和vless?

配置步骤通常包括:

  • 获取配置文件:从相关网站或社区获取配置文件。
  • 安装V2Ray:确保系统中已经安装了V2Ray。
  • 修改配置文件:根据自己的需求修改vmess或vless的配置。
  • 启动服务:保存修改后,重新启动V2Ray服务。

4. vmess和vless哪个更安全?

在安全性方面,vmess及vless均采用强加密方式,安全性基本上相当。命令的使用和配置安全性更依赖于用户的操作。

结论

通过本文的分析,希望您能够对vmessvless有一个清晰的理解,能够帮助您选择合适的协议来保护网络隐私与安全。在实际应用中,根据具体情况合理选择将大大提升网络体验。

正文完
 0